China’s intangible cultural heritage lacquer fan is a traditional handicraft made with lacquer-coated bamboo or wooden ribs and canvas, using natural lacquer to create unique patterns through splashing and staining. Its "painting with lacquer" technique leverages lacquer’s water resistance to form unpredictable yet intentional designs, making each fan a one-of-a-kind work of art. Beyond a cooling tool, it embodies thousands of years of cultural heritage.

Lacquer art, a revered traditional craft in China, traces its roots back over 8,000 years. Originating from the sap of the lacquer tree, this ancient technique blends intricate woodworking, carving, inlaying, and painting to create objects of both functional beauty and profound cultural significance. Today, it continues to thrive as a bridge between tradition and modernity, inspiring global creativity and cultural dialogue.

The Meaning and Significance of the Tibetan Prayer Wheel

by LinWenjing on feb 17 2025
The Tibetan prayer wheel, also known as the prayer wheel, is a sacred object deeply rooted in Tibetan Buddhist culture. It is a cylindrical device practitioners use to accumulate merit, purify negative karma, and invoke blessings. This article explores the meaning of the prayer wheel, its definition, and its spiritual significance in Tibetan Buddhism. What is a Prayer Wheel? A prayer wheel is a traditional Tibetan Buddhist tool used for prayer and meditation. It typically consists of a cylindrical container, often made of metal, wood, or leather, mounted on a handle. Inside the cylinder, sacred texts, mantras, or prayers are inscribed on paper or parchment. The most common mantra inside a prayer wheel is "Om Mani Padme Hum," a powerful Buddhist chant associated with compassion and enlightenment. The prayer wheel's meaning lies in its function: each rotation of the wheel is believed to release the blessings of the mantras and prayers contained within, equivalent to reciting them aloud. This practice allows practitioners to engage in continuous prayer, even while performing other tasks. The Spiritual Significance of the Prayer Wheel In Tibetan Buddhism, it is believed that spinning the prayer wheel generates positive energy, purifies negative karma, and brings peace and harmony to both the practitioner and their surroundings. Each turn of the wheel symbolizes the turning of the "Wheel of Dharma," which represents the Buddha’s teachings and the path toward enlightenment. Key Beliefs: Accumulation of Merit: Every rotation of the prayer wheel is said to accumulate merit, contributing to spiritual growth and liberation from the cycle of rebirth. Purification: Spinning the wheel is believed to purify negative karma and clear obstacles on the path to enlightenment. Compassion: The mantras inside the wheel, like "Om Mani Padme Hum," invoke the blessings of Chenrezig (Avalokiteshvara), the Bodhisattva of Compassion, helping the practitioner cultivate a compassionate heart. How to Use a Prayer Wheel Using a Tibetan prayer wheel requires mindfulness and respect. Here are some guidelines for proper usage: Direction: The prayer wheel should always be turned clockwise from the perspective of the person holding it. This aligns with the natural movement of the sun and the universe in Tibetan Buddhist cosmology. Grip: The wheel can be held in either hand, but it must be turned gently and steadily. Avoid using excessive force or spinning it too quickly. Intention: While turning the wheel, focus on cultivating compassion, mindfulness, and positive intentions. This enhances the spiritual benefits of the practice. Speed: The ideal speed is about 2-3 rotations per second, allowing for a smooth and meditative experience. Types of Prayer Wheels There are two main types of prayer wheels: Handheld Prayer Wheels: These are small, portable wheels that individuals carry and spin manually. They are commonly used by Tibetan Buddhists in their daily practice. Large Prayer Wheels: These are stationary wheels found in monasteries, temples, and public spaces. They are often powered by wind, water, or electricity and contain thousands of mantras. Spinning a large prayer wheel is believed to generate immense merit due to the vast number of prayers it contains. The World's Largest Prayer Wheels With the economic and social development of Tibetan Buddhist communities in China, five "world's largest prayer wheels" were built in Yunnan, Qinghai, Sichuan, and Gansu provinces starting from 2009. The prayer wheel in Xiangshan, Guanyinqiao Township, Jinchuan County, Aba Tibetan and Qiang Autonomous Prefecture in Sichuan, completed in 2017, stands at a height of 27.6 meters, with a diameter of 10 meters and weighing 124 tons. It surpassed the prayer wheel in Guidi, Qinghai, and became the largest in the world. These large prayer wheels are not only spiritual landmarks but also tourist attractions, drawing visitors from around the world to witness their grandeur and significance. The Symbolism of the Prayer Wheel The prayer wheel definition goes beyond its physical form; it is a symbol of the interconnectedness of all beings and the continuous flow of compassion and wisdom. The act of spinning the wheel represents the cycle of life, death, and rebirth, as well as the aspiration to break free from this cycle and attain enlightenment.   Conclusion The Tibetan prayer wheel is a profound spiritual tool that embodies the essence of Tibetan Buddhist practice. Its meaning lies in its ability to transform ordinary actions into opportunities for spiritual growth and enlightenment.
